oil light
hi! i do rebult of my 912 engine this winter,(new pistons and rings) i start my engine this week end and the oil light stay on... i disconnect the wire to the sensor and my light turn off. what do you think? bubble air arroud the sensor? new sensor?
thanks Mic 912 |

Well first
I suspect you have a wiring problem. The light should go ON when the cable is disconnected. But do not use your engine to troubleshoot the oil pressure light.
I would recommend that you find an oil pressure GUAGE that you can hook up via a hose - this will help you confirm that you have oil pressure. Mark Petry Bainbridge Island, WA |
